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Relation pid/vid et Physical Drive

1 réponse
Avatar
LostRailler
Bonjour,

Voil=E0 je vous expose mon probl=E8me. Je suis en C.
Je cherche =E0 faire la relation entre le pid/vid d'un dongle et son
physical drive.

Je r=E9cup=E8re le pid/vid en passant comme GUID {0xa5dcbf10, 0x6530,
0x11d2, {0x90, 0x1f, 0x00, 0xc0, 0x4f, 0xb9, 0x51, 0xed}}
et le physical drive en passant {0x53f56307, 0xb6bf, 0x11d0, {0x94,
0xf2, 0x00, 0xa0, 0xc9, 0x1e, 0xfb, 0x8b}}.

Je n'arrive pas =E0 faire correspondre les 2 (Tel pid/vid correspond =E0
tel physical drive). Sachant que je ne peux pas me baser sur le num=E9ro
de s=E9rie.
Y a t'il une possibilit=E9 ?

Je suis sous Windows XP avec Visual C++ 6.

Merci d'avance.

1 réponse

Avatar
Christian ASTOR
On 21 oct, 11:10, LostRailler wrote:

Voilà je vous expose mon problème. Je suis en C.
Je cherche à faire la relation entre le pid/vid d'un dongle et son
physical drive.

Je récupère le pid/vid en passant comme GUID {0xa5dcbf10, 0x6530,
0x11d2, {0x90, 0x1f, 0x00, 0xc0, 0x4f, 0xb9, 0x51, 0xed}}
et le physical drive en passant {0x53f56307, 0xb6bf, 0x11d0, {0x94,
0xf2, 0x00, 0xa0, 0xc9, 0x1e, 0xfb, 0x8b}}.

Je n'arrive pas à faire correspondre les 2 (Tel pid/vid correspond à
tel physical drive). Sachant que je ne peux pas me baser sur le numéro
de série.
Y a t'il une possibilité ?



Avec la Setup Api et DeviceIoControl(), on récupère normalement ce que
l'on veut.
Voir, entre autres, l'exemple de la KB264203